Bamori Protected Forest
Bamori Protected Forest is a forest reserve in Madhya Pradesh, Plains. Bamori Protected Forest is situated nearby to the locality Bamori Abda, as well as near the village Tānga.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Jatara
Town
Jatara is a town and a nagar palika parishad in Tikamgarh district in the Indian state of Madhya Pradesh. Jatara is situated 8 km west of Bamori Protected Forest.
